Operation Definition
Putting in or on biological or synthetic material that physically reinforces and/or augments the function of a portion of a body part
Procedure Overview
Supplement procedures add biological or synthetic material to reinforce or augment a lower joint that is still structurally present but needs additional support. Ligament reconstruction, such as an ACL or PCL graft in the knee, is the classic example, along with labral augmentation in the hip or cartilage grafting. Unlike replacement, the native joint stays in place; the surgery strengthens a weakened or torn portion of it.
Grafts can come from the patient's own tissue, a donor, or synthetic material, and the choice often depends on age, activity level, and the structure being reinforced. These procedures are common after athletic injuries, aiming to restore stability so the joint can withstand normal or athletic loads again.
Anatomy & Axis Detail
Ankle Joint, Right
The right ankle joint, the tibiotalar articulation bearing the body's full weight during stance and gait, is supplemented when its native cartilage, capsule, or ligamentous restraints have degraded beyond simple repair but a joint-replacing device is not warranted. A biological or synthetic patch, autologous cartilage graft, or ligament augmentation is placed to reinforce the talar dome or malleolar mortise, restoring the tight congruity this joint depends on for stable dorsiflexion and plantarflexion. Because the ankle mortise tolerates very little laxity before developing early arthritis, surgeons documenting this procedure specify which surface or ligament received the supplementing material, and whether the graft was autograft, allograft, or a nonbiologic substitute, since the device type changes the code's qualifier.
Approach: Open
Open approach means the surgeon cuts through skin, mucous membrane, or other tissue layers to physically expose the target site to view before performing the procedure. It gives direct visualization and hands-on access, distinguishing it from Percutaneous approaches where instruments pass through a small puncture without exposing the site. Open is typical for procedures needing wide access, such as most laparotomies.
Device: Synthetic Substitute
Synthetic Substitute designates a device made from manufactured, non-biologic material, such as mesh or prosthetic components, used to replace or augment a body part. It is distinguished from the two tissue substitute categories by its artificial composition, which carries different considerations for integration and long-term durability than biologic grafts.
Coding & Documentation
Coders assign Supplement when documentation shows material was added to reinforce an existing body part rather than substitute for it, which requires confirming the native structure was not removed. Graft type, whether autograft, allograft, or synthetic, factors into the device value. A recurring mistake is coding a ligament reconstruction as Repair when a formal graft was placed, or conversely coding Supplement when the graft actually replaced a joint surface rather than reinforcing intact tissue.
